I think she was too young to be married, or at least, I've usually found that people married later in life than that. Usually they seemed to be in their late twenties.

Genline doesn't have moving out records for that year on their site. I did find her birth record.

Lovisa was born 7 August 1851 in Grevie and was baptised 10 August. Parents were the shoemaker Hellgren (no given name was listed) and his wife Pernilla Olsdotter?? Parents lived at Salomonhög 4 in that parish. Salomonhög was a village and 4 was a farm.

I didn't find the birth of Nils Petter in a VERY quick search of birth records so perhaps he was born in a different parish or maybe I just missed him. I don't have time to search the household examination records to see the parents and siblings of your Lovisa but my guess is that he was a brother or perhaps a cousin. Brother seems likely but it takes time to search the parish records and I don't have that time right now.

The M you saw was med or medakänd (spelling?) meaning who she was with.

'Skoyner' must have been an attempt to phonetically spell Skåne, the province where she lived.
